Time 4 Learning is an online home education program that mixes fun with learning!  This program is not only for homeschoolers but it works for after school learning/tutoring and summer instruction as well.  My kiddos love to do anything on the computer so this review was right up their alley.  There's some online academic instruction and then some fun- what a perfect combo!

The Time 4 Learning program offers language arts and math and is considered a comprehensive program for preschool, elementary school, and middle school. Science and social studies programs are provided as a free bonus for most grades.  Another bonus is that if your child is on different grade levels for reading and math skills, Time 4 Learning tailors the program to meet your child's specific needs.

Parents can track your child's progress throughout the program as well as participate in the "Parent Community & Forum" area.  Below is an example of a progress report you may see regarding your child's work in the program:

In all seriousness (I can be serious?), I really did like this program. The "Getting Started" Area was super helpful and answered all my questions. It talks about things like "Where does my child start? How do I track my child's progress? What do I do if I need help or want to ask questions? Can I preview a lesson? How many lessons should my child do every day (I have 1 extremely motivated child who would actually do 10 lessons and ask for more!)? And how do I use the lesson plans provided?" So do you wanna try it out? Here's the details:

No contracts! Cancel at any time!
$19.95 per month for the first child
$14.95 per month for each additional child
Two-week money back guarantee!
